What is Air Balancing?

So, what’s the big deal with air balancing? It’s all about ensuring that conditioned air – you know, the warm air in winter or the cool breeze in summer – is evenly distributed throughout a space. When the heating or cooling isn’t just right, it can turn an inviting room into a chilly cave or a sweaty sauna.

Proper air balancing adjusts the airflow in different areas of the duct system. This ensures that every room feels comfortable and well-regulated. Imagine walking through a home where one room is warm, while another feels like a refrigerator—frustrating, right? Air balancing is the solution that fixes that problem.

Why Does Air Balancing Matter?

Let’s dig deeper into why this process is the MVP of HVAC systems. Below are a few key reasons:

  • Comfort: When air is evenly distributed, everyone in the room can enjoy consistent heating or cooling. Nobody wants to shuffle between hot and cold areas!

  • Energy Efficiency: A well-balanced system doesn’t strain to pump excessive air into certain zones. This can dramatically lower energy costs. After all, who doesn't love saving a few bucks on their utility bills?

  • Reduced Wear and Tear: When your HVAC system runs smoothly, it avoids undue stress. This means fewer repairs and a longer lifespan for your system—a win-win!

How is Air Balancing Achieved?

Okay, so we understand what air balancing is and why it's important. Let’s get into how it’s done.

  1. Adjustment of Dampers: These little devices play a crucial role in controlling airflow in duct systems. By adjusting dampers, a technician can direct more or less air to specific areas of the building.

  2. Modifying Ductwork: Sometimes, the need for adjustment lies in the duct design itself. If it's not optimally configured, make changes to the layout to improve airflow.

  3. Changing Fan Speeds: Some systems come with variable-speed fans. Altering the fan speed can also help balance airflow, making sure every nook and cranny is comfortably heated or cooled.
